Somatic Cell Count in milk is commonly used as an indicator of what udder condition?

Explanation:
The main idea here is that somatic cell count reflects udder health by signaling an inflammatory and immune response in the mammary gland. When an infection like mastitis is present, white blood cells rush into the milk to fight bacteria, causing the somatic cell count to rise. This makes SCC a reliable indicator of mastitis, including subclinical cases where there are no obvious symptoms but the immune system is active. Higher SCCs are associated with reduced milk quality and can indicate contagious infection and animal welfare concerns. Dehydration changes overall milk concentration but doesn’t specifically indicate udder infection; fat and protein content describe milk composition rather than immune activity in the udder.
